Risk Evaluation & Underwriting

Analyze new and renewal submissions to assess exposure, loss history, financial condition, and overall risk quality.
Determine appropriate pricing, terms, and conditions in accordance with company guidelines and market conditions.
Structure casualty programs including primary, excess, and specialty liability coverages.
Apply sound judgment to balance risk appetite with business development goals.

Portfolio & Account Management

Manage a book of business to achieve profitability, retention, and growth targets.
Monitor account performance, loss trends, and industry developments to adjust underwriting strategies.
Maintain accurate documentation and ensure compliance with internal policies and regulatory requirements.

Broker & Client Engagement

Develop and maintain strong relationships with brokers, agents, and insureds.
Communicate underwriting decisions clearly and negotiate terms effectively.
Participate in client meetings, underwriting audits, and market presentations.

Collaboration & Internal Partnership

Work closely with actuarial, claims, risk engineering, and product teams to evaluate complex risks.
Contribute to product development, underwriting guidelines, and strategic initiatives.
Mentor junior underwriters or underwriting assistants as needed.
